Abstract
- Creep behavior at room temperature was firstly observed in nanocrystalline Gd 2 Zr 2 O 7 ceramic (NC-GZO) having an average grain size about 7.8 nm. The creep strain rate sensitivity of NC-GZO was calculated, and many dislocations can be observed in the strained region. The mechanism causing this room temperature creep behavior was associated with the dislocations slipping which most likely occurs though grain boundaries sliding. [ABSTRACT FROM AUTHOR]
